When does Maksymilian celebrate his name day? Calendar of the most important dates

Maksymilian most often celebrates his name day on August 14 and October 12. By far the most popular and celebrated date of Maksymilian's name day in Poland is August 14 – the liturgical feast of Saint Maximilian Maria Kolbe, Polish martyr of Auschwitz. Other dates in the calendar include March 12, May 29, and October 12. These days offer a great opportunity to extend warm wishes to the celebrant.

Origin, Latin etymology and glorious meaning of the name Maksymilian

The name Maksymilian has Latin origin. It originated in ancient Rome from the name "Maximilianus", an elaboration of the classical Roman cognomen "Maximus" (meaning "greatest") or a combination of two esteemed Roman names: *Maximus* and *Aemilianus*. Literally, the name Maksymilian translates as "the greatest", "outstanding", "achiever of greatness", or "descendant of the Aemilius family". The name carries a dignified, strong, and prestigious tone. In Poland, it has been recorded since the Middle Ages, enjoying great popularity among the nobility and modern Polish families.

The meaning of the name Maksymilian in Polish martyrdom, painting and global entrepreneurship

Notable figures named Maksymilian have earned international renown. Foremost in Poland is Saint Maximilian Maria Kolbe (1894–1941) – Franciscan friar, founder of Niepokalanów, missionary, and martyr who in Auschwitz concentration camp voluntarily offered his life in exchange for fellow prisoner Franciszek Gajowniczek, becoming a global symbol of heroic love for one's neighbor. In art, Maksymilian Gierymski was an outstanding realist painter of the 19th century, master of atmospheric landscapes and Polish January Uprising scenes. In global commerce, Max Factor (born Maksymilian Faktorowicz) was a Polish-Jewish cosmetics pioneer who founded the global Max Factor empire in Hollywood and revolutionized modern screen cosmetics. This name embodies heroic self-sacrifice, artistic realism, and pioneering entrepreneurship.

Diminutives and shortenings of the name Maksymilian

The name Maksymilian is shortened in Polish in convenient and affectionate ways: Maks, Maksio, Maksik, Maksymilianek, Maksiu, Maksiunio. The most popular everyday diminutives are definitely *Maks* and *Maksio*.

Famous figures bearing the name Maksymilian (Maximilian)

This name was and is borne by prominent saints, artists, and innovators:

  • Saint Maximilian Maria Kolbe (1894–1941) – Polish Franciscan priest and martyr of Auschwitz, canonized by John Paul II.
  • Maksymilian Gierymski (1846–1874) – outstanding Polish realist painter and insurgent.
  • Max Factor (Maksymilian Faktorowicz, 1872–1938) – Polish-born founder of the Max Factor cosmetics empire.
  • Maximilian I (1459–1519) – Holy Roman Emperor of the House of Habsburg.
